Fence Builders on the Sunshine Coast 2026

The Sunshine Coast has a growing and competitive fencing market. Fencing work in Queensland over $3,300 must be carried out by a QBCC-licensed contractor. Pool safety barriers must comply with the Queensland Development Code and a licensed pool safety inspector must inspect all barriers. Verify QBCC licences at qbcc.qld.gov.au.

How Much Does Fencing Cost on the Sunshine Coast 2026?

  • Colorbond steel fence (1.8m high, per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$80-$138 per metre in Sunshine Coast
  • Colorbond steel fence (2.1m high, per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$95-$158 per metre in Sunshine Coast
  • Treated pine paling fence (1.8m high, per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$60-$108 per metre in Sunshine Coast
  • Hardwood timber paling fence (1.8m high, per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$75-$130 per metre in Sunshine Coast
  • Pool safety glass panel fence (per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$170-$360 per metre in Sunshine Coast
  • Pool safety Colorbond fence (per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$120-$205 per metre in Sunshine Coast
  • Aluminium slat fence (1.8m high, per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$150-$260 per metre in Sunshine Coast
  • Concrete sleeper retaining wall and fence (per lineal metre, supply and install), typically $230-$460 per metre in Sunshine Coast

What to Know Before Building a Fence on the Sunshine Coast

Queensland's Neighbourhood Disputes Resolution Act 2011 governs dividing fence cost sharing. Noosa Shire Council has strict planning controls for fencing in character zones, front fencing in Noosa Heads and Noosaville character zones may require development approval and must complement the streetscape character. Sunshine Coast's high termite pressure means treated pine or steel and aluminium fencing are preferred for long-term durability. Coastal Sunshine Coast properties near Noosa Main Beach, Coolum, and Maroochydore experience salt air that accelerates fencing hardware corrosion, marine-grade fixings are recommended for beachside properties.
